Background
The reducer is an independent part consisting of gear drive, worm drive and gear-worm drive enclosed in a rigid shell, is commonly used as a reduction drive device between a prime mover and a working machine, and the hobbing machine is the most widely applied machine tool in gear processing machines, and can cut straight teeth and helical cylindrical gears, and can also process worm gears, chain wheels and the like.
Under the inside gear of production speed reducer, need use the gear hobbing machine to process, current gear hobbing machine uses the gear hobbing to carry out cutting down the gear periphery and can produce a large amount of metal sweeps, these sweeps often directly fall inside the organism to by the staff unified clear brush after the processing, a large amount of efforts have been consumed, and the metal sweeps that falls at will still drops easily to clean dead angle, pile up with lubricating oil and greasy dirt etc. for a long time, directly influence the life of gear hobbing machine.

Referring to fig. 1-2, the gear hobbing machine for producing the reducer gear in the embodiment includes a gear hobbing machine 1, the gear hobbing machine 1 is composed of a machine base 11, a rail 12 and a machine top 13, the machine base 11 is fixedly supported as a whole, a roller 14 is movably installed on the machine base 11 by connecting an internal control mechanism, a base of the roller 14 is fixedly and hermetically connected with an air tank 204 and is rotatably and hermetically connected with a tank cover 205, so that the inside of the air tank 204 is kept in a sealed state, the rail 12 is fixedly installed on the machine base 11, the rail 12 is slidably connected with a blocking door 211, so that the blocking door 211 can slidably block splashed metal scraps, a movable frame 15 fixedly connected with a receiving hopper 210 is slidably installed on the rail 12, a mounting rod 16 movably connected with the machine base 11 is arranged on the movable frame 15, the mounting rod 16 is used for fixedly installing a shaft to be machined and can drive the shaft to be machined to rotatably cut a tooth profile, the machine top 13 is fixedly arranged at the top of the machine base 11, and the gear hobbing machine 1 is provided with the cleaning device 2.
In this embodiment, cleaning device 2 includes pneumatic assembly, drive assembly and cooperation subassembly, and pneumatic assembly, drive assembly and cooperation subassembly all set up on each subassembly of gear hobbing machine 1, and pneumatic assembly and drive assembly interconnect are used for the cooperation to collect the sweeps, and it is loaded down with trivial details to avoid the later stage to clean the process.
Pneumatic assembly includes air pump 201, air pump 201 fixed mounting is at the top of gear hobbing machine 1, the intercommunication of air outlet department of air pump 201 has the trachea 202 that runs through and extend to gear hobbing machine 1 processing region top, the intercommunication has hose 203 on the trachea 202, hose 203 intercommunication has the air tank 204 of fixed connection gear hobbing machine 1, air tank 204 outside is provided with nozzle 209, the quantity of nozzle 209 is two, the intercommunication is on drive assembly from top to bottom, buckle towards gyro wheel 14 department simultaneously, make nozzle 209 can blow the metal sweeps that produces to the processing of gyro wheel 14 and drive, avoid the metal sweeps directly to fall down, intercommunication through trachea 202 and hose 203, make air pump 201 can admit air nozzle 209, and then blow off the metal sweeps to the processing region.
The driving assembly comprises a motor 207 and a box cover 205, the motor 207 is fixedly arranged on the inner wall of the left side of the air box 204, a gear shaft 208 is fixedly arranged on an output shaft of the motor 207, a bearing sleeve fixedly connected with the inner bottom wall of the air box 204 is rotatably arranged outside the gear shaft 208, the rotation of the gear shaft 208 is stabilized through the bearing sleeve, the rotation of the gear shaft 208 can be stabilized and is kept meshed with a gear of a rack 206, the box cover 205 is rotatably connected with the air box 204, a sealing ring is fixedly arranged at the joint part, the box cover 205 is kept in a closed state under the relative rotation with the air box 204, a rack 206 meshed with the gear of the gear shaft 208 is fixedly arranged on one side surface of the box cover 205 facing the inside of the air box 204, the rack 206 is fixedly arranged on one side surface of the box cover 205 close to the air box 204 in an annular shape and is kept meshed with the gear of the gear shaft 208 under the rotation, so that the box cover 205 can drive the nozzle 209 to perform rotary air injection, thereby improving the blowing effect of the air jet.
Cooperation subassembly is including stopping door 211 and connecing hopper 210, stop door 211 and pass through sliding connection in the front of gear hobbing machine 1, can block the metal sweeps that splashes under the stable cutting process, connect hopper 210 fixed mounting in gear hobbing machine 1, and be located the processing area below, connect hopper 210 to be wide-mouthed funnel-shaped spare, wide-mouthed orientation gyro wheel 14 and installation pole 16 department simultaneously, connect hopper 210 outside still to be provided with the fluid-discharge tube that has the filter screen, can collect the discharge to decurrent coolant liquid through the fluid-discharge tube, avoid remaining in a large number and cause the influence to the cleanness on the gear hobbing machine.
The working principle of the above embodiment is as follows:
under the condition of gear machining, the drum drives the motor 207, so that the motor 207 drives the gear shaft 208 to rotate, the rack 206 drives the box cover 205 and the air box 204 to rotate relatively under the rotation of the gear shaft 208, thereby driving the nozzle 209 to rotate toward the processing area of the roller 14, performing air blowing by the air pump 201, the air pump 201 is used for inflating the air tank 204 through the communication between the air pipe 202 and the hose 203, and simultaneously the air is sprayed out from the nozzle 209, the metal scraps generated in the processing areas of the roller 14 and the mounting rod 16 are uniformly blown off and are uniformly collected under the receiving of the receiving hopper 210 outside the bottom end of the mounting rod 16, thereby avoiding the complex workload caused by later manual cleaning, meanwhile, the cooling liquid flowing down along the mounting rod 16 can be collected and discharged, and unnecessary troubles caused by the fact that the cooling liquid and metal scraps are mixed and accumulated in the gear hobbing machine 1 are avoided.
